A Collection of Books and Offprints by or About Einstein, Some Related to Relativity
Albert Einstein. A Collection of Thirty-Nine Books and
Offprints. [Various places: various publishers, various dates].
Consisting of the following books: Albert Einstein:
Philosopher-Scientist. First edition, one of 760 copies
signed by Einstein. [And:] Die Evolution der
Physik (written with Leopold Infeld). Later German
edition. [And:] Essays in Science. Abridged
edition. First edition in English; and another later copy.
[And:] Theodore von Karman. Anniversary
Volume. Inscribed by Karman. Einstein contributed to
an article on pages 212-225. [And:] Die
Naturwissenschaften. The volume for 1935 of this magazine
of natural science (no apparent link to Einstein or relativity).
[And:] The Drift of Civilization. First
American edition. Einstein wrote an article on pages 101-108.
[And:] The World as I See It. Later edition.
[And:] The Philosophy of Bertrand Russell.
First trade edition. Einstein is mentioned several times.
[Together With the Following Magazines or Offprints:]
Annalen der Physik.1901. First edition of
Einstein's first publication ("Folgerungen aus den
capillaritatserscheinungen" on pages 523-523. This copy bound
in cloth. Chemised in slipcase. [And:] Entwurf Einer
Verallgemeinerten Relativitatstheorie... 1913. Wrappers.
One of Einstein's most important papers on Relativity.
[And:] Physica. Two volumes, one from 1926, the
other from 1928. Einstein has an article ("Toespraak bij de
herdenking...") on page 20 of the 1926 volume. Both in later
library bindings. [And:] Vierteljahrsschrift der
Astronomischen Gesellschaft, 1922-1928. Twenty issues of
this magazine on astronomy in wrappers (unknown what Einstein
association this is). [And:] Sammlung Vieweg. Uber die
spizielle und die allemeine Relativitatstheorie. 1920.
[And:] Die Atomtheorie (by Dr. Leo Graetz),
1922. Related to Relativity. [And:] Das
Relativitatsprinzip (by A. Brill). 1920. Related to
Relativity. [And:] Das Problem des Absoluten Raumes
und Seine Beziehung Zum Allgemeinen Raumproblem (by Aloys
Muller), 1911. Related to Relativity. [And:] Gesprach
uber die Atomtheorie (by Dr. Hans Schimank), 1921. Related
to Relativity. [These last five volumes in matching later library
bindings]. Generally very good.
